If counter space is at an all-time low in your kitchen, consider an oven microwave built in combo to reduce space. The top models come with huge oven capacities and versatile microwave capabilities.
They use microwave radiation to heat food by causing water molecules to vibrate at a rapid rate. Some cook with convection hot air fanned for baking and roasting.
Space Savings
A kitchen remodel can be a great opportunity to increase functionality without needing to increase floor space. This could include incorporating an oven microwave combo that combines the capabilities of a traditional oven with the microwave to create a more versatile appliance. They can be used as a microwave for heating foods quickly but also have the ability to roast, bake, and cook food items. They typically offer a greater variety of cooking options than microwaves that are standalone or stand-alone ovens and offer more convenience for busy homeowners.
The installation of microwave combo ovens is dependent on your requirements and budget. Countertop models can be placed on the countertop in your kitchen and connect to the power source, while built-in models are incorporated directly into your cabinets for an elegant look and simple installation. Many models include the option of a trim kit to close the gap between the microwave and cabinet to create seamless appearance. They can be hung on the walls to save space in your kitchen.
Oven microwave combos are available in a variety of sizes based on the amount of cooking you perform at home. A single-door model usually has a capacity of 1.4 cubic feet, whereas a double-door oven has up to 5.3 cubic feet of room. It's not enough space for a large dinner gathering, but it's sufficient for most families to manage their everyday food preparation.
Some models feature sensors that allow you to control the steam cycle. It automatically adjusts the power, duration and temperature to ensure your food is cooked evenly. Some models can use hot air convection or fanned to cook grill and roast your food to give it a crisp texture. They can be used instead of a traditional oven to save time and effort, while delivering superior results.

Convenience
Microwave combination units combine the versatility of both an oven for the wall and a microwave, resulting in an appliance that can be used for a broad variety of tasks. The microwave part of the appliance is perfect for heating up leftovers, pre-packaged microwaveable meals and other food items that are quick to cook and the oven is a complete set of roasting, baking and broiling capabilities to prepare delicious dishes made from scratch.
Microwave ovens work by generating a high-frequency radiation that heats the water molecules present in food. This is a faster process than an ordinary oven, and can be used to reheat and defrost frozen foods. A conventional oven is the best choice for larger dishes such as roasts for families or baked potato and chicken. This is why an oven and microwave combo is a good idea in a lot of homes, particularly if you are limited in space for kitchen appliances.
These units are installed within the kitchen cabinets, freeing up counter space while giving your kitchen an enhanced look. Depending on your cabinet design certain models come with flush installation options to create an overall look in your kitchen. This is a great choice for homeowners looking to improve their kitchen without the need for a complete remodel. You can simply cut holes in your cabinets, and then put the unit in place at the correct height.
If you're a busy cook who isn't able to take the time to clean, consider a microwave oven combo that has an automatic self-cleaning mode. This feature uses steam for stubborn messes, eliminating the necessity of manually scrubbing. Many of these models also have a sensor steam cycle which analyzes the moisture levels to provide the best cooking conditions for various food items.
If you're looking for a powerful kitchen appliance that is versatile consider microwave oven combos equipped with a convection oven. This technology adds a different heating method to the microwave part of the appliance. This can help make your dishes brown and bake more evenly. Some models include a Sabbath mode and variable broil settings to give precise results when cooking.
Cooking Options
A microwave oven combo provides the convenience of a countertop microwave, while also offering the versatility of a traditional wall oven. They're available in sleek, modern designs that offer an elegant, sleek look in your kitchen, and feature powerful functions that save you time and help cook more efficiently.
The microwave part of a combination wall oven microwave makes use of microwave radiation to heat food by stirring the water molecules inside it. The traditional oven functions as a single wall oven, and can bake food items, roast or broil them. Some models allow you to bake multiple items simultaneously by using both functions.
Combination microwaves can be used to quickly cook food and heat leftovers. If you rarely cook or bake at home, a countertop microwave and wall-mounted oven could be a more economical option for your kitchen.
Many microwave combos offer a variety of advanced features not available in standalone microwaves. Some models have speed-convection which circulates hot air inside the oven to bake and cook food more evenly. Certain models come with smart connectivity built-in, allowing you monitor and control the oven from your smartphone.
Microwave oven combos are available in several different installation styles such as built-in, over the-range and drawer styles. Over-the-range models can be installed over your stove to free up counter space while built-in microwaves fit inside a cabinet or on a wall for a more integrated appearance. Trim kits can be used to fill any gaps around the appliance.
If you're considering upgrading your microwave on your countertop with a built-in model, think about the size of your kitchen to ensure it's got enough space to allow for adequate ventilation. A majority of microwaves built-in require between 15 and 22 inches of cabinet depth for adequate airflow.
